During the weekend of the 15th Annual Award
Luncheon ArtTable organized a weekend of events
to celebrate the luncheon beginning with a membership
meeting and reception on Thursday, May 8th; Dutch
Treat Topic Dinners the evening of the 9th; and
a Saturday of events in New York.
